The most common and recent 4-letter answer for ""Get outta my hair!," in a text" is MYOB.
The clue suggests a phrase often used to tell someone to stop interfering or being nosy. 'MYOB' stands for 'Mind Your Own Business,' a common expression used in such contexts, especially in informal communication like texting.
This clue was last seen in the NYT Crossword on January 12, 2026.
MYOB is an acronym for 'Mind Your Own Business,' a phrase used to tell someone to stop meddling.
